    I used to take mine out a couple times a week. I even went as far to get one of those lizzy harnesses that goes aorund their front two legs and has a string attached to it. Just watch out because they can run pretty fast and never, NEVER touch their tail. They can come off very easily and when they grow back they don't look like the original.
